I would like to bring to your notice a fraud committed by your employees by delivering a faulty Taigun Car to me that is running at an average of 4.5 Km/litre.
I purchased a Taigun Highline 1.0 from Noida (Viraj Automobiles), all relevant documents attached for your reference. I live in Kanpur city and have been using the vehicle in this city. I purchased it from Noida because of the lesser waiting time.
Abysmally, since day 1 I have been getting a mileage of 4.5 Km/Litre on Highway. I have highlighted the same to the Kanpur dealership and service centre and the car has been checked multiple times by the team. However, till date no resolution has been provided to me. The car is still at the service centre.
Mileage of 4.5 Km/Litre has been testified by the Kanpur dealership as well when their technician drove the vehicle on PSIT highway along with me. We filled the tank(auto cut) at 2, 414 Km and again refilled it at 2, 454 Km(auto cut). 8.96 Litres of petrol was used by the car during this journey.
Volkswagen claims a mileage of 17-19 Km/litre and I am thoroughly disappointed by this behavior and commitment from the team.
I am completely fed up with this vehicle and this is not what one expects after paying INR 16, 00, 000 and from a brand like Volkwagen.
Please refund my money on priority basis. I do not want this vehicle even if you can fix the problem. Also, please compensate me for the extra fuel that has been consumed so far. I have lost complete faith and trust on Taigun and on the brand Volkswagen as well.
